10 William Barrows Way, Tipton, DY4 9EA is a freehold semi-detached property built between 2007-2011. The property offers approximately 1,141 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£288,962 , which equates to approximately £253 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Apr 2024 for £263,000. Since then, the value has increased by £25,962, representing a 9.9% increase, or approximately 4.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£288,962 is:

  • 1.9% lower than the average property price on William Barrows Way
  • 17.2% higher than the average in the DY4 9EA postcode area
  • and 25.6% higher than the average price for Tipton as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 31 October 2025,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

10 William Barrows Way, Tipton, Sandwell, West Midlands, DY4 9EA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 31 Oct 2025.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 19 Feb 2024. The rating of C rem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 1.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 250 mm loft insulation to pitched,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from good to very good.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 89% of fixed outlets to excellent lighting efficiency, with no change in efficiency (very good).
